The tiny, 0.1 watt GPS jammer at the upper left can cause a huge outage. This is the amount of power your phone charger uses when it is done charging your phone and just idle.
The colors represent the maximum PDOP in the area, with the no color area unable to get a GPS signal because of the jamming.

GPS data for the first 4 months of 2025 is now up at github.com/tdriver/2025...
Data includes SEM almanacs, Precise ephemeris, broadcast ephemeris, Satellite Outage Files (SOF, Performance Assessment Files (PAF) and Prediction support Files (PSF)

First, set a deprecation policy to manage expectations.
How you version is up to you - in the route, in the header, doesn't make too much of a difference. But - definitely HAVE a version somewhere. And don't waffle on following your deprecation policy, it only generates tech debt.
